What changes
What changes for the school team
There are two things here, and the second is worth more than the first. The alert is for today: whoever is at the gate looks up and goes out to get him. What changes the street is the other one. If at that same spot children cross away from the crossing fourteen times a day, always at the same hour and always through the same gap between two parked cars, that is not bad luck: it means the crossing is in the wrong place, or that two parking spaces there are two too many. Today that conversation with the council rests on the teachers' impression. With IRIS it rests on a count by day, by hour and by spot — which is what gets a crossing moved.
What people usually ask
Can IRIS stop a child from stepping into the road?
No, and promising it would be a lie. IRIS alerts: it does not stop a car, it does not close a street and it does not hold anyone back. What it achieves is that someone finds out at the time instead of afterwards, and that the school and the council know how often it happens, at what hour and at which spot. The person who decides and acts is always a person.
Does it recognise the children crossing or the cars going past?
No, neither. IRIS does not identify anyone: it does not recognise faces, it does not compare them against any database, it does not store who anyone is and it keeps no record on anyone. Nor does it read number plates: in a school that function is not switched on. The detection is 'there is a small person in the roadway and a vehicle is coming in that lane', and that is the whole of the data.
What is the count for, if the alert already arrives?
The alert solves the moment. The count solves the street. A crossing gets moved, a speed hump gets painted or someone gets posted on that corner when somebody can show that children cross badly there every day at the same hour. That is a figure per spot and per time band, and outside a school nobody had it until now. It is the difference between asking for something and showing that it is needed.
